Mirion Medical is a global leader in developing technology solutions that advance the safety, efficiency and quality of care in Radiation Therapy, Nuclear Medicine, Medical Imaging and Occupational Dosimetry. From diagnosis through treatment we enhance the delivery and ensure the safety of healthcare. With practitioners and patients as our inspiration, we create advanced technology that improves lives. Our work results in reduced risk and harnessed opportunity – where it matters most.
At Mirion, we foster a culture of integrity, collaboration and continuous improvement empowering our teams to make a meaningful impact every day.
We have an exciting opportunity for a Clinical Application Specialist within our SUN Nuclear business, which forms part of the wider Mirion Medical group.
This is a remote working position based in either Australia or New Zealand.
Key Responsibilities
The role will cover two main areas of responsibility providing training and support to customers who may experience issues with their software product.
- Effectively deliver independent onsite and remote educational training on the use of Sun Nuclear products
- Complete all pre-work and effectively communicate the training plan to the customer
- Assist in the development of training materials including but not limited to Power Point presentation, syllabus, and user documentation/instructions
- Interface with customers to resolve cases and assist in troubleshooting escalated issues in a timely manner
- Identify customer needs and determine internal resources needed for resolution
- Document promptly and correctly in Salesforce and/or TaskRay all activities related to each Training, Adoption or Support task, including but not limited to emails, phone calls and signed documents
- Attend conferences and trade shows as needed
- Create Knowledge base articles on processes and troubleshooting steps to help the team if similar issues are encountered in the field
- Perform other related duties as assigned or requested occasionally
- BSc or MSc in Medical Physics, Dosimetry or a related field
- Fluent in English both written and verbally
- A background in Radiation Oncology
- Clinical experience in Radiation Therapy is a plus
- Strong training delivery skills, able to convey complex topics in a clear and effective way
- Good communicator – clear with excellent presentation skills,confident in presenting ideas both in person and remotely
- Self-motivated, detail-oriented, well organised, able to manage time and multiple tasks efficiently
- Good technical aptitude, comfortable with web-based tools and learning new technologies and industries standards
- Flexible and able to adjust to changing priorities and situations
- Strong analytical skills to interpret complex information, troubleshoot and resolve issues
- Open-minded and able to think outside the box
- Attentive to customer and team feedback
- Works well independently and as part of a team
- Willingness to travel to client sites
